What if instead of having a deadline for each round, any of the songs scores could be improved until the cumulative rounds ended? That way if lower division players did strive and improve themselves throughout the weeks of the tournament, they could attack a song from a previous week to represent their current skill. Then there would be no chance a player who skill boosted would be negatively impacted by prior round scores they could improve at their current state.

It also has some additional benefits like:
- Helping reduce the huge chunk of people who end up blowing off the tourney for one reason or another, by allotting them more time for prior songs.
- Giving newer players a greater amount of time to be acclimated to the tournament environment, and getting their barrings.
- A greater incentive to improve, and get the best possible scores you can (because you are never safe unless you AAA this way, since scores in the cumulative rounds could be improved throughout)
- I would also imagine the greater improvement incentive would raise competitive spirits as well

I know this would essentially make "rounds" in the cumulative phase arbitrary though, but it's just a thought. This also has nothing to do with the elimination portion of the tournament. What would be problematic with something like this?
